What is NADPH? NADPH is a coenzyme. Explanation: The full form of NADPH is nicotinamide adenine dinucleotide phosphate hydrogen. It is a reduced form of NADP+, and is found in both plants and animals. NADPH acts as a coenzyme, aiding those enzymes that catalyze anabolic pathway reactions. It...
